Abstract
The present invention relates to a kind of salt resistance alkali compositions and preparation method thereof, belong to salt resistance alkali technical field.Salt resistance alkali composition provided by the invention comprises the following components in parts by weight: 10~15 parts of willow extract monomer, and 120~150 parts of filter residue fermentation material, 20~30 parts of peat, 0.1~0.3 part and 0.1~0.3 part of zinc sulfate of iron edta sodium salt.Salt resistance alkali composition of the present invention has facilitation to plant growth, is suitble to salt-soda soil to use, can effectively improve salt-soda soil and turn waste into wealth, avoid wasting.

Specific embodiment
The present invention provides a kind of salt resistance alkali compositions, comprise the following components in parts by weight:
10~15 parts of willow extract monomer, 120~150 parts of filter residue fermentation material, 20~30 parts of peat, ethylenediamine tetra-acetic acid
0.1~0.3 part and 0.1~0.3 part of zinc sulfate of ferrisodium salt;
The preparation method of the willow extract monomer and filter residue fermentation material the following steps are included:
1) willow bark or branch be dried, crushed, is sieved and microwave drying, obtaining willow powder;
2) using deionized water as solvent, the continuous extraction of ultrasound adverse current is carried out to willow powder, centrifugation obtains filtrate and filter residue;
3) filtrate for obtaining step 2) is concentrated, and obtains extract medicinal extract;
4) the extract medicinal extract that step 3) obtains is spray-dried, obtains willow extract monomer;
5) filter residue and EM probiotics are mixed into the 6~8d of aerobe fermentation that acts charitably, it is dry, obtain filter residue fermentation material;
The restriction of the not no chronological order of the step 3) and the step 5).
Salt resistance alkali composition of the present invention includes 10~15 parts of willow extract monomer and filter residue fermentation material 120~150
Part.Salt resistance alkali composition of the present invention includes willow extract;The willow extract includes willow extract monomer and filter
Slag fermentation material.In the present invention, the willow extract monomer contains a variety of growth-promoting substances such as salicin, nucleotide and amino acid
Substance, can promote plant growth and saline-alkali tolerance (nucleotide is the composition unit of plant nucleic acid, participates in fission process,
Especially adenosine acid derivative synthesis that the polysaccharide such as starch, cellulose are participated in as glucose activation, amino acid conduct
The composition unit of protein participates in the synthesis of structural proteins and functional protein);The filter residue fermentation material contains mixture organic matter
Amount improves, and is applied in soil and increases soil organic matter content, and can increase soil permeability, is conducive to moisture regulation.
Willow bark or branch is dried, crushes, is sieved by the present invention and microwave drying, obtains willow powder.In the present invention
In, the willow is Salicaceae (Salicaceae) sallow, and the kind of the willow preferably includes bamboo willow, dry land willow or hangs down
Willow.The present invention does not have special restriction to the operating method of the drying, crushing, sieving and microwave drying, using this field skill
Conventional practices known to art personnel.In the present invention, the partial size of the willow powder is 30~50 mesh.
After obtaining willow powder, the present invention carries out the continuous extraction of ultrasound adverse current using deionized water as solvent, to willow powder, from
The heart obtains filtrate and filter residue.In the present invention, the temperature of the extraction be 50~95 DEG C, preferably 70 DEG C~90 DEG C, more preferably
It is 80 DEG C.The method that the present invention continuously extracts the ultrasound adverse current does not have special restriction, ripe using those skilled in the art
The continuous extract equipment of conventional Ultrasound adverse current known extracts.
After obtaining filtrate and filter residue, obtained filtrate is concentrated the present invention, obtains extract medicinal extract.The present invention is preferred
It is concentrated into specific gravity 1.03~1.05.
After obtaining medicinal extract, obtained extract medicinal extract is spray-dried by the present invention, obtains willow extract monomer.?
In the present invention, the inlet air temperature of the spray drying is 160~190 DEG C, and more preferably 180 DEG C, leaving air temp is 55~65 DEG C,
More preferably 60 DEG C.
After obtaining willow extract monomer, filter residue and EM probiotics are mixed into the 6~8d of aerobe fermentation that acts charitably by the present invention, are done
It is dry, obtain filter residue fermentation material.In the present invention, the EM probiotics is preferably that Xuzhou Sen Tian Biotechnology Co., Ltd produces
" gloomy field " board EM probiotics.In the present invention, the filter residue and the mass ratio of EM probiotics are preferably (800~1000) kg:
(200~250) g, more preferably 1000kg:200g.In the present invention, after the filter residue and EM probiotics mix, water content is excellent
It is selected as 60~70%, more preferably 68%.In the present invention, the temperature of the aerobic fermentation be 45 DEG C~70 DEG C, preferably 50
~65 DEG C, more preferably 60 DEG C.
Salt resistance alkali composition of the present invention includes 20~30 parts of peat, more preferably 25 parts.In the present invention, the mud
Charcoal can improve soil water regime.The present invention does not have special restriction to the source of the peat, using the city of conventional peat
Sell product.
Salt resistance alkali composition of the present invention includes 0.1~0.3 part of iron edta sodium salt, more preferably 0.2 part.
Iron edta sodium salt of the present invention can provide ferro element for plant.The present invention is to the sodium iron ethylene diamine tetra acetate
The source of salt does not have special restriction, using the conventional commercial product of iron edta sodium salt.
Salt resistance alkali composition of the present invention includes 0.1~0.3 part of zinc sulfate, more preferably 0.2 part.Sulphur of the present invention
Sour zinc provides Zn-ef ficiency for plant, promotes plant growth.The present invention does not have special restriction to the source of the zinc sulfate, uses
Zinc sulfate conventional commercial product well known to those skilled in the art.
In salt resistance alkali composition of the present invention, extract of willow bark monomer contains acidic materials, and filter residue fermentation material contains
Part beneficial microbe colony is able to maintain the state of activation of zinc, iron, promotes absorption of the plant to zinc, ferro element.Peat is implicit
Moisture further keeps the activity and validity of each ingredient in composition.Each component interaction neutralizes soil alkaline, increases
The content of organic matter, growth-promoting beneficial microbe colony, improve plant due to saline and alkaline caused by zinc, asiderosis, collectively promote Genes For Plant Tolerance
Saline alkali.

Embodiment 1
Step 1: selecting the age of tree to be greater than 2 years bamboo willow barks is raw material, it dry, pulverize, using 20 mesh screens, bamboo willow is made
Bark powder;Using continuous microwave drying method, 60 DEG C of drying temperature, bamboo willow bark powder, 30 mesh of powder particle size is made after dry.
Step 2: 0.8 ton of bamboo willow bark powder is taken in parts by weight, using the ultrasonic continuous extract equipment of adverse current, using solvent
For deionized water, extract under conditions of 65 DEG C, be centrifuged after extraction by horizontal helical type, revolving speed 2500rpm, then by butterfly from
The heart, revolving speed 7000rpm obtain extracting filtrate A, filter residue B after centrifugation.
Step 3: filtrate A is concentrated into specific gravity 1.04, extract medicinal extract C is obtained.
Step 4: medicinal extract C enters spray dryer, 180 DEG C of inlet air temperature, 60 DEG C of leaving air temp, willow extract is obtained
Monomer D.
Step 5: tap water and leavening is added in filter residue B, make to mix water content of matter 65%, carries out aerobic fermentation, fermentation
Time is 6 days, and natural drying is dry, obtains filter residue fermentation material E.
Step 6: by 10 parts of D of willow extract monomer, 120 parts of filter residue fermentation material, 20 parts of peat, iron ethylenediaminetetraacetate
It 0.2 part of sodium salt, 0.2 part of zinc sulfate, is sufficiently mixed uniformly, obtains the salt resistance alkali composition of the extract containing willow.
Embodiment 2
The salt resistance alkali composition field trial of the extract containing willow
Test is implemented: experimental cultivar is the long eggplant in Xuzhou, and experimental setup three processing, respectively control is (using non-saline and alkaline
Normal soil is cultivation matrix), take light saline-alkali soil (salt content 3/1000ths) as cultivation matrix and with light saline-alkali soil (salt content thousand
/ tri-) cultivation matrix is used as after mixing with the salt resistance alkali composition of the extract containing willow.Wherein, anti-containing extract of willow bark
Saline and alkaline preparation method of composition being applied every plant of application 0.5kg when to be colonized, being mixed well with saline-alkali soil with embodiment 1, plant life
The long consistent eggplant seedling of situation.Other management conditions are consistent, in the maturity period, are measured to eggplant upgrowth situation and yield etc..
Merely using light saline-alkali soil as cultivation matrix, eggplant seedling is gradually dead after field planting;Light saline-alkali soil (salt content thousand/
Three) the eggplant seedling after mixing with the salt resistance alkali composition of the extract containing willow as substrate culture normal growth and can be formed
Yield, yield are the 85.67% of the eggplant yield of non-saline and alkaline normal soil cultivation.This shows the salt resistance of the extract containing willow
Alkali composition can significantly improve eggplant saline-alkali tolerance.
Embodiment 3
The salt resistance alkali composition field trial of the extract containing willow
Test site: In Jixi County of Anhui Proyince.Test period: in May, 2018 --- in August, 2018.
Test is implemented: experimental cultivar is cucumber, and experimental setup three processing, respectively control are (using non-saline and alkaline normal
Soil is cultivation matrix), with light saline-alkali soil (salt content 3/1000ths) be cultivation matrix and with light saline-alkali soil (salt content thousand/
Three) cultivation matrix is used as after mixing with the salt resistance alkali composition of the extract containing willow.Wherein, the salt resistance alkali group of the extract containing willow
Closing object, the preparation method is the same as that of Example 1, applying every plant of application 0.6kg when to be colonized, mixing well with saline-alkali soil, transplants upgrowth situation
Consistent cucumber seedling.Other management conditions are consistent, in the maturity period, are measured to cucumber growth situation and yield etc..
Merely using light saline-alkali soil as cultivation matrix, cucumber seedling is gradually dead after field planting;Light saline-alkali soil (salt content thousand/
Three) cucumber seedling after mixing with the salt resistance alkali composition of the extract containing willow as substrate culture normal growth and can be formed
Yield, yield are the 72.25% of the cucumber yield of non-saline and alkaline normal soil cultivation.This shows anti-containing extract of willow bark
Salt alkali composition can significantly improve cucumber saline-alkali tolerance.
Embodiment 4
Step 1: selecting the age of tree to be greater than 2 years bamboo willow barks is raw material, it dry, pulverize, using 30 mesh screens, bamboo willow is made
Bark powder;Using continuous microwave drying method, 60 DEG C of drying temperature, bamboo willow bark powder, 30 mesh of powder particle size is made after dry.
Step 2: take 1 ton of bamboo willow bark powder in parts by weight, using the ultrasonic continuous extract equipment of adverse current, use solvent for
Deionized water is extracted under conditions of 65 DEG C, is centrifuged after extraction by horizontal helical type, revolving speed 2500rpm, then by butterfly from
The heart, revolving speed 7000rpm obtain extracting filtrate A, filter residue B after centrifugation.
Step 3: filtrate A is concentrated into specific gravity 1.05, extract medicinal extract C is obtained.
Step 4: medicinal extract C enters spray dryer, 190 DEG C of inlet air temperature, 65 DEG C of leaving air temp, willow extract is obtained
Monomer D.
Step 5: tap water and leavening is added in filter residue B, make to mix water content of matter 70%, carries out aerobic fermentation, fermentation
Time is 8 days, and natural drying is dry, obtains filter residue fermentation material E.
Step 5: by 12 parts of D of willow extract monomer, 130 parts of filter residue fermentation material, 30 parts of peat, iron ethylenediaminetetraacetate
It 0.2 part of sodium salt, 0.3 part of zinc sulfate, is sufficiently mixed uniformly, obtains the salt resistance alkali composition of the extract containing willow.
Embodiment 5
The salt resistance alkali composition field trial of the extract containing willow
Test is implemented: experimental cultivar is tomato, and Kimberley kind, experimental setup three processing, respectively control is (using non-
Saline and alkaline normal soil is cultivation matrix), be cultivation matrix with light saline-alkali soil (salt content 3/1000ths) and (contained with light saline-alkali soil
Salt amount 3/1000ths) mixed with the salt resistance alkali composition of the extract containing willow after as cultivation matrix.Wherein, it is extracted containing willow bark
The salt resistance alkali composition preparation method of object being applied every plant of application 0.5kg when to be colonized, being mixed well with saline-alkali soil with embodiment 4,
Transplant the consistent tomato seedling of upgrowth situation.Other management conditions are consistent, in the maturity period, carry out to tomato growth situation and yield etc.
Measurement.
Merely using light saline-alkali soil as cultivation matrix, tomato seedling is gradually dead after field planting;Light saline-alkali soil (salt content thousand/
Three) tomato seedling after mixing with the salt resistance alkali composition of the extract containing willow as substrate culture normal growth and can be formed
Yield, yield are the 86.33% of the tomato yield of non-saline and alkaline normal soil cultivation.This shows the salt resistance of the extract containing willow
Alkali composition can significantly improve tomato saline-alkali tolerance.
